HotelsClick.com

Hotel Leo Jardines De Isla Canela

2 Stars

  Avda. de la Mojarra,s/n - 21409 - Isla Canela, Spain View Map

These coastal apartments are the ideal destination for friends, families and couples. Amenities include Satellite / Cable TV . We have Cot for children. The facilities Sun beds are rounded off with the pool.

Booking.com

Hotel facilities

  •  Garage

The Hotel Leo Jardines De Isla Canela offers an internal garage to park a car which will be sheltered from the weather.

Rooms facilities

  •  Satellite TV
Book